BLACK v. DELBELLO

No. 82 Civ. 7850 (CBM).

575 F.Supp. 28 (1983)

Lord James Joseph BLACK, Plaintiff, v. Alfred B. DELBELLO, Westchester County Executive; Albert Gray; Norwood Jackson; Samuel F. Schnitta; and Joseph Stancarey, Defendants.

United States District Court, S.D. New York.

June 6, 1983.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Lord James Joseph Black, plaintiff pro se.

Semel, Boeckmann & Skydel, New York City, for defendants.


M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ER

MOTLEY, Chief Judge.

This is a civil rights action brought pursuant to 42 U.S.C. § 1983.
